Unmanned Ground Vehicles (UGV) Market Is Projected to Reach USD 3.91 Billion By 2029

Exactitude Consultancy Press release: Global Unmanned Ground Vehicles (UGV) Market:

The increasing demand from the defense and security sectors for unmanned systems, including unmanned ground vehicles (UGVs), is a significant driver of the market growth.

Investment in the research and development of these vehicles has increased as a result of the rising demand for Ugvs in the defense and security industries. To meet consumer demand, manufacturers are making significant investments in the creation of novel, cutting-edge UGVs. UGVs are employed in the defence and security sectors for a wide range of tasks, including surveillance, reconnaissance, gathering intelligence, and counterterrorism operations. This broad range of applications is encouraging the creation of specialised UGVs that are capable of completing particular tasks.

UGVs can do operations that would normally need human staff, making them a cost-effective alternative for the defence and security industries. They are also helpful for jobs that are too risky or challenging for people to handle. They can be employed when human personnel is not safe to be present, such as in dangerous locations or during emergencies. This increases the staff members’ sense of safety and security.

To build a complete unmanned system for surveillance and reconnaissance activities, UGVs can be connected with other unmanned systems like unmanned aerial vehicles (UAVs). The creation of fresh, cutting-edge unmanned systems is being driven by this integration.

Overall, as manufacturers attempt to develop new and improved UGVs to fulfil the needs of their clients, the growing demand for unmanned systems from the defence and security sectors is fueling the expansion of the UGV market. The development of tailored UGVs for particular applications and the incorporation of UGVs with other unmanned systems to produce complete unmanned solutions are both being influenced by this demand.

Advancements in autonomous technology, including AI, machine learning, and sensor technology, are playing a critical role in driving the market growth for unmanned ground vehicles (UGVs).

Due to advancements in autonomous technology, UGVs can now operate more autonomously and successfully. UGVs can now navigate more complicated situations and come to their own conclusions based on the information they gather. UGVs are now able to carry out a larger range of duties, from logistics and demining to surveillance and reconnaissance, thanks to the use of AI and machine learning. UGVs are more adaptive and versatile since they may be configured to carry out particular duties.

UGVs are becoming safer and more effective due to the use of sensor technology, which enables them to identify and avoid obstacles as well as gather and transmit data in real-time. The growing demand for autonomous solutions in numerous industries, including defense, agriculture, and mining, is driving the development of more complex UGVs. As the advantages of autonomous technology are more widely understood, this demand is anticipated to increase.

The high initial investment and operating costs associated with unmanned ground vehicles (UGVs) can be a significant restraint for the market growth of UGVs.

The adoption of UGVs by small and medium-sized organisations that do not have the financial capacity to engage in such technology may be constrained by the high initial investment and operational costs of UGVs.

UGVs need routine maintenance and repairs, which can be expensive given their sophisticated technology and unique parts. UGVs require professional operators who have received training in both maintenance and operation. This may raise labour expenses and reduce the pool of available qualified workers.

Overall, the high initial investment and ongoing operational costs related to UGVs can be a major barrier to the market’s expansion for UGVs. UGVs may become a more affordable and competitive choice for numerous industries, though, as the technology develops and is more extensively used. The cost of UGV development and adoption can also be lessened with the aid of government financing and support.

Technical challenges related to the development of advanced autonomous systems for unmanned ground vehicles (UGVs) can be a significant restraint for the market growth of UGVs.

The functioning of UGVs and their capacity to carry out certain activities may be constrained by technical issues. For example, limitations in sensor technology may limit the ability of UGVs to function in specific situations. the safety of UGVs may also be affected. For instance, shortcomings in the technology for detecting and avoiding obstacles can result in mishaps and harm to the UGV.

It can be challenging to create sophisticated autonomous systems for UGVs, requiring advanced engineering and software development skills. The price of development and time to market may rise as a result. Technological difficulties that cause compatibility problems and development delays can also occur when integrating various systems and technologies into UGVs.

Overall, technical difficulties associated with the creation of highly advanced autonomous systems for UGVs may significantly impede the commercial expansion of UGVs. To overcome these obstacles and enhance the technology, industry and academic researchers can work together and continue to engage in research and development. Government assistance can also lessen the financial strain of UGV development and promote innovation in this field.

Emerging applications for Unmanned Ground Vehicles (UGVs) in new and existing industries such as healthcare, logistics, and e-commerce are likely to contribute significantly to the growth of the UGV market in the coming years.

UGVs can be programmed to carry out a range of functions, including transportation, material handling, and inventory management. UGVs can be used to move goods within warehouses and distribution centres in sectors like logistics and e-commerce, freeing up human workers to concentrate on more difficult jobs. This may result in increased production and efficiency, which in turn may enable businesses to make financial savings and boost their bottom line.

UGVs can be utilised to complete jobs that are risky or challenging for human personnel to complete. For instance, UGVs can be utilised in healthcare environments to convey medical supplies and equipment, lowering the danger of harm to hospital employees. In the logistics industry, UGVs can be utilized to handle hazardous commodities, lowering the danger of exposure to employees.

UGVs can be designed to carry out tasks with high levels of accuracy, which lowers the possibility of mistakes. UGVs can be used to transport medication and other supplies, ensuring that they are delivered to the proper position every time, in sectors like healthcare where precision is essential.

The integration of Unmanned Ground Vehicles (UGVs) with other unmanned systems, such as drones and unmanned aerial vehicles (UAVs), can create more comprehensive unmanned solutions that offer a wide range of benefits.

Companies can create more flexible and dynamic unmanned systems that can be used in a variety of settings by integrating UGVs with drones and UAVs. A UGV can be used to investigate a potential hazard and perform necessary duties, such cleaning or repairs, while a drone can be used to survey the area and find any hazards. Efficiency can be increased by integrating UGVs with drones and UAVs since it enables smooth coordination between various unmanned systems. As a result, tasks may take less time to perform and data gathering and analysis may be more accurate.

Companies can develop more complete solutions with a larger range of capabilities by integrating the advantages of various unmanned systems, such as the mobility of UGVs and the aerial vision of drones. For instance, a UGV with a camera might be used to check difficult-to-reach places while a drone may provide an aerial picture of the surrounding region to aid in the UGV’s navigation.

Overall, there are a number of advantages to integrating UGVs with other unmanned systems that can support the market expansion for UGVs. Businesses may raise productivity, safety, and overall performance by developing more adaptable, effective, and capable unmanned systems, which will boost UGV use and demand.

Unmanned Ground Vehicles (UGV) Market Key Players

The unmanned ground vehicles (UGV) market key players include BAE Systems, Aselsan A.S., Lockheed Martin Corporation, General Dynamics Corporation, L3Harris Technology, Inc, Oshkosh Defense, LLC An Oshkosh Corporation Company, Rheinmetall AG, Teledyne FLIR LLC., QinetiQ, and Northrop Grumman Corporation
